Description
Artemis Resources Limited is a mineral exploration and development company primarily focused on the discovery and advancement of gold, copper, and lithium deposits in Western Australia. The company holds significant interests in several well-known projects, including the Greater Carlow Castle gold-copper-cobalt project in the West Pilbara region, the Paterson Central gold-copper project adjacent to major discoveries in the Paterson Province, and the Osborne joint venture, which targets high-grade lithium mineralization. Artemis also owns the Radio Hill processing plant, a strategic asset situated 35 kilometers from Karratha, and noted as the only processing plant of its kind in the region.
Founded in 2003 and headquartered in West Perth, Artemis Resources Limited has a history of consolidating a wide exploration tenement portfolio before narrowing its focus to its most prospective assets. Its operations span across the production and development of key battery and precious metals, positioning the company as a contributor to both traditional and emerging sectors within the materials industry. Artemis’s projects are designed to support the growing demand for metals critical to renewable energy, electrification, and technology supply chains, making it an influential participant in Australia’s resource development landscape.
